Output ddd3ff63a00a5f41ec5aef10d4829bfe979518f137c5c9c8bee16a2b2d04a284:0

value
181385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023e8619cc69833df278aaa677dd1cc84016a9c9 OP_EQUAL
address
31ttBACMEWnEsvrVFpmkaatdxG766CXVJ1
transaction
ddd3ff63a00a5f41ec5aef10d4829bfe979518f137c5c9c8bee16a2b2d04a284
confirmations
18322
spent
true